Message on World Day Against Child Labour
On the occasion of World Day Against Child Labour, Pujya Swami Chidanand Saraswati ji, the President of Parmarth Niketan, emphasised that childhood is not permanent for children. If it is stolen from them, it will never return. Illiteracy and child labour perpetuate a cycle of insecurity, where successive generations remain trapped in a state of vulnerability. This, in turn, leads to ongoing concerns related to livelihood security and social welfare.
